Calendar

View all calendars is the default. Choose Select a Calendar to view a specific calendar.

Select the arrows on either side of the current month to change the month.

Community Events

  1. Needham Community Theatre presents "Ramona Quimby"

    May 5, 2023, 8:00 PM - May 14, 2023, 5:00 PM
    @
    Newman Elementary School Auditorium

    Based on the beloved children's books by Beverly Cleary, "Ramona Quimby" is a funny, heartwarming and charming play for families ages 5 and up. Run by volunteers for over 65 years, Needham Community Theatre is an award winning community theatre presenting professional quality theater in our own backyard.

    More Details

Memorial Park Trustees Sign Board

  1. (LG) Exchange Club Needham Classic Car Show

    May 7, 2023 - May 13, 2023
    @
    Large Sign facing the Public Library

    More Details

Public Meetings Calendar

  1. CANCELLED Needham School Committee School Facilities Subcommittee

    May 12, 2023, 8:30 AM - 9:30 AM

    More Details
  2. Board of Health (Hybrid)

    May 12, 2023, 9:00 AM - 11:00 AM
    @
    In Person: Charles River Room Via Zoom: meeting ID 873 8015 5786 and passcode 397134

    Needham Board of Health AGENDA Friday May 12, 2023 9:00 a.m. to 11:00 a.m. Public Services Administration Building – Charles River Room 500 Dedham Avenue, Needham MA 02492 & via Zoom To listen/view this meeting, download the “Zoom Cloud Meeting” app in any app store or at www.zoom.us. At the above date and time, click on “Join a Meeting” and enter the meeting ID 873 8015 5786 and passcode 397134 or click the link below to register: https://us02web.zoom.us/j/89106908441?pwd=Wjl5L2NXRXRuOWFLRUNVc09XaDRSdz09

    More Details
  3. DVAC Needham Domestic Violence Action Committee

    May 12, 2023, 9:00 AM

    More Details
  4. PLANNING BOARD

    May 12, 2023, 9:00 AM
    @
    Virtual Meeting using Zoom Meeting ID: 880 4672 5264

    NEEDHAM PLANNING BOARD Friday, May 12, 2023 9:00 a.m. Virtual Meeting using Zoom Meeting ID: 880 4672 5264 (Instructions for accessing below) To view and participate in this virtual meeting on your phone, download the “Zoom Cloud Meetings” app in any app store or at www.zoom.us. At the above date and time, click on “Join a Meeting” and enter the following Meeting ID: 880 4672 5264 To view and participate in this virtual meeting on your computer, at the above date and time, go to www.zoom.us click “Join a Meeting” and enter the following ID: 880 4672 5264 Or to Listen by Telephone: Dial (for higher quality, dial a number based on your current location): US: +1 312 626 6799 or +1 646 558 8656 or +1 301 715 8592 or +1 346 248 7799 or +1 669 900 9128 or +1 253 215 8782 Then enter ID: 880 4672 5264 Direct Link to meeting: https://us02web.zoom.us/j/88046725264

    More Details
Facility Submit Event Print Email Event Subscription View RSS Feeds Select on Calendar Expand Collapse Previous Next Down Up Map Share Show more
Agenda